Watercolor painting is a beautiful and versatile medium that can be enjoyed by artists of all skill levels. If youre new to watercolor painting, this beginner tutorial will help you get started and learn the basics of this wonderful art form. First, youll need to gather your supplies. Youll need watercolor paper, watercolor paints, brushes, a palette, and water. Its important to use quality supplies to ensure the best results in your paintings. Next, youll want to familiarize yourself with the basic techniques of watercolor painting. One of the most important techniques to master is wet-on-wet painting, where you apply wet paint to a wet surface. This technique allows colors to blend and bleed into each other, creating beautiful, soft transitions. Another important technique is wet-on-dry painting, where you apply wet paint to a dry surface. This technique allows for more control and precision in your painting. Youll also want to practice layering colors to create depth and dimension in your paintings. Start with light washes of color and gradually build up layers to achieve the desired effect. Experiment with different brush strokes and techniques to create a variety of textures and effects in your paintings. Dont be afraid to make mistakes – watercolor is a forgiving medium that allows for experimentation and creativity. As you practice and gain more experience with watercolor painting, youll develop your own unique style and techniques. Remember to have fun and enjoy the process of creating beautiful works of art with watercolors

Watercolor Beginner Tutorial Materials needed: - Watercolor paper - Watercolor paints - Watercolor brushes - Water cup - Paper towel Step 1: Set up your workspace Choose a well-lit and clean area to work in. Place your watercolor paper on a flat surface and have all your materials within reach. Step 2: Prepare your watercolor paints Squeeze out a small amount of each color you will be using onto a palette or a plate. Add a few drops of water to each color to activate the paint. Step 3: Practice your brushstrokes Before starting your painting, practice different brushstrokes on a separate piece of paper. Experiment with different brush sizes and techniques to see how they affect the paint. Step 4: Start painting Begin by wetting your brush and picking up some paint. Start applying the paint to your paper, using light pressure for lighter colors and heavier pressure for darker colors. Remember to leave white spaces for highlights. Step 5: Add layers Allow each layer of paint to dry before adding another layer on top. This will prevent the colors from bleeding into each other and create a more vibrant painting. Step 6: Experiment with different techniques Try using different techniques such as wet-on-wet, wet-on-dry, and dry brushing to create different effects in your painting. Start with the basics: Before diving into more advanced techniques, familiarize yourself with the basic supplies needed for watercolor painting. This includes watercolor paper, brushes, watercolor paints, and a palette.
Practice blending: Watercolor painting is all about blending colors seamlessly. Practice blending different colors together to create smooth transitions and gradients.
Experiment with different techniques: There are many different techniques you can use in watercolor painting, such as wet-on-wet, wet-on-dry, and dry brushing. Experiment with these techniques to see which ones you prefer.
Study color theory: Understanding color theory will help you create harmonious color palettes in your watercolor paintings. Learn about complementary colors, analogous colors, and color temperature.
Start with simple subjects: Begin by painting simple subjects, such as flowers, fruit, or landscapes. This will help you practice your skills and gain confidence in your abilities.
Watch tutorials: There are countless watercolor tutorials available online that can help you learn new techniques and improve your skills. Watch tutorials from experienced artists to learn their tips and tricks.
Dont be afraid to make mistakes: Watercolor painting is a forgiving medium, as you can always layer more paint on top of mistakes. Embrace the imperfections in your work and use them as learning opportunities.
